City of Williamsburg announces voter registration deadline
The City of Williamsburg has announced 4:30 p.m. April 9 as the voter registration deadline for the May 1 City Council election.
Three City Council seats will be decided in the election. Voters must be 18 on or before May 1 to register to vote.
Registered voters who won't be available May 1 may apply for an absentee ballot by mail until April 24 and apply for an absentee ballot in person by April 28.
A forum featuring candidates for City Council will be held at 7 p.m. April 10 at the Stryker Building, 412 N. Boundary St., Williamsburg.
